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Pitsea to East Didsbury start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pitsea to East Didsbury start from £81.40 one way, or £116.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pitsea to East Didsbury are available for £205.20 one way, or £410.40 return

Everything you need to know about Pitsea Station

Welcome to Pitsea Station: Your Gateway to Adventure

Sitting proudly in the heart of Essex, Pitsea train station serves as a vital cog in the region's transportation network. Whether you're commuting for work or planning an excursion, this station is perfectly equipped to meet your travel needs. Let's dive into what Pitsea Station has to offer.

Facilities at Pitsea Station

Travelers will appreciate the convenience of the ticket office at Pitsea station, open from the early hours of the morning until late at night. From Monday to Friday, it operates from 05:15 to 20:00, Saturday from 06:15 to 20:00, and Sunday between 06:45 to 20:45. Not to worry if you prefer purchasing your tickets on the go—ticket machines are available for easy access, along with facilities to collect tickets bought online.

Pitsea Station boasts step-free access throughout, including lift access to all platforms and ticket barriers with accessible ticket machines. The station is well-equipped for travelers who need additional support, featuring induction loops and ramps for train access. The staff is available to assist from Monday to Friday, from 06:00 to 21:00, ensuring a smooth and comfortable journey for all passengers.

Enhancing your comfort are facilities such as CCTV, seating areas, and accessible toilets situated in the booking hall, which can be accessed with a RADAR key.

Everything you need to know about East Didsbury Station

Welcome to East Didsbury Train Station

Nestled in the vibrant suburbs of South Manchester, East Didsbury train station serves as a convenient hub for commuters and travelers in the region. Whether you’re a frequent rider heading into the hustle and bustle of Manchester or a visitor exploring the charms of the British countryside, this station caters to your journey with facilities designed for comfort and ease.

Facilities and Ticketing

East Didsbury is equipped with essentials to ensure your travel is smooth. The station features a ticket office that operates during the morning hours from Monday to Saturday, allowing you to purchase or collect pre-booked tickets conveniently. There are also ticket machines available for those outside these hours, including accessible machines for those with limited mobility. While there aren't any refreshment facilities on site, the seamless ticketing process will get you on your way without fuss.

Accessibility and Support Services

The station strives to provide an inclusive experience with some level of step-free access and accessible ticket machines. For assistance, staff are available to help during the morning hours on weekdays and Saturdays. Additionally, ramp access ensures ease for those needing it to board trains. While amenities like secure bicycle storage, wheelchairs, or waiting rooms are not available, customer help points ensure assistance is never too far away.
